Barcelona Promotes Xavi Espart to First Team After Impressive Pre-Season
Barcelona have moved quickly to lock in one of their most eye-catching academy performers, promoting 19-year-old defender Xavi Espart to the first team after an impressive pre-season under Hansi Flick, according to Mundo Deportivo.
The decision comes with full backing from the club’s sporting structure. Flick has been struck by the teenager’s maturity and adaptability, while sporting director Deco has also given his approval after closely tracking Espart’s displays over the summer.
From Squad Number 36 to 12
Espart’s breakthrough moment arrived on the opening weekend of La Liga. Wearing the No. 36 shirt, he started at left-back as the champions swept aside Elche 5-0, a statement win that doubled as his own quiet announcement on the big stage.
That number will not be on his back for long. Barcelona have now reassigned him the No. 12 shirt for La Liga, a clear signal that he is no longer just an emergency option from the academy but part of the senior group.
Versatility that Flick Trusts
Flick’s admiration is rooted in more than one solid performance. Espart offers the kind of tactical flexibility modern coaches crave. He can play on either flank at full-back, drop into defensive midfield or operate in central midfield, giving Barcelona an extra piece that fits multiple parts of the board.
That range has accelerated his rise. In a squad juggling injuries, rotations and a demanding calendar, Espart’s ability to cover both defence and midfield makes him a valuable tool, not just a prospect to be protected.
